______ are to proteins as ______ are to nucleic acids

Amino acids are to proteins as nucleotides are to nucleic acids.
Amino acids are the monomers of the polypeptide chain that are synthesised during the translation process from the mRNA. The basic structure of all the amino acids is the same. They contain a carbon atom at the middle and three chemical bases along with a differing R group,
Nucleotides are the monomers of the nucleic acid. They are composed of three parts namely sugar molecule,  nitrogenous bases and a phosphate molecule.

So, the correct option is 'Amino acids, nucleotides'
